WONDERS OF OUR UNIVERSE IN CONCERT

Embark on an enchanting evening filled with discovery, music, and art. Each moment carefully crafted to produce a visually breathtaking and emotionally charged voyage through the cosmos, presented in a unique storytelling style that unleashes the imagination and stimulates inspiration across all ages. We’ll traverse the mysteries of stars, planets, galaxies, and black holes, and engage in the quest for life beyond Planet Earth, exploring ‘The Power of Smallness’ and something exceptionally moving and empowering for our younger attendees, their date with ‘Destiny’.

 
Join us for a memorable night of family entertainment that speaks to all ages, brought to life by Astrophysicist Ian Hall and the electrifying sounds of string quartet Storm, playing famous music from science and science fiction.


13th June 2024 – The Embassy Theatre – Skegness
